Code Analysis: DCO Comment Attachment 2.1.0

Most Complex Classes

Class Rating Complexity
DCO_CA
B
82
DCO_CA_Base
A
54
DCO_CA_Settings
S
40
DCO_CA_Admin
S
40

Most Complex Functions

Function Rating Complexity
DCO_CA::form_element()
A
12
DCO_CA_Base::get_allowed_file_types()
A
11
DCO_CA::check_attachment()
A
13
DCO_CA_Settings::field_render()
A
10
DCO_CA_Base::get_attachment_preview()
A
9
DCO_CA::display_attachment()
A
8
DCO_CA_Settings::field_allowed_file_types_render()
A
7
DCO_CA_Settings::get_fields()
S
1
DCO_CA::save_attachment()
S
6
DCO_CA_Admin::delete_attachment_action()
S
7
DCO_CA::filter_upload_mimes()
S
7
DCO_CA_Settings::register_settings()
S
6